How Our Ceiling Water Extraction Process Works
At our company, we understand that every water damage job is unique, and we’ll tailor our approach to meet your specific needs. Here’s an overview of our process:
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our technicians will arrive at your home and conduct a thorough inspection of the damage, taking note of the extent of the water damage, the type of water involved (clean, gray, or black), and any potential safety hazards.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ment, including wet vacuums and pumps, to remove the standing water from your ceiling and surrounding areas.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our crews will set up drying and dehumidification equipment to remove excess moisture from the air and speed up the drying process.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ize any surfaces that came into contact with the water to prevent mold and bacterial growth.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the job is complete and meet the required standards.

Ceiling Water Extraction Cost in Perry Hall, MD
The cost of Ceiling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Perry Hall, MD. Here are some estimated price ranges for different services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The extent of the water damage, the type of water involved, and the size of the affected area.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of water involved, and the number of days required for drying.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of surfaces involved, and the level of contamination. |
